Chapter 15 - Solutions of Acids and Bases - Questions and Exercises - Questions - Page 672: 15.3

Answer

$2 CH_3COOH \lt -- \gt CH_3COO{H_2}^+ + CH_3COO^-$

Work Step by Step

- In autoionization reactions, we have 2 molecules of an amphoteric substance, where one of them is going to react as an acid, and the other as a base. - Therefore, one of the molecules is going to donate a proton ($CH_3COO^-$), and the other is going to receive one ($CH_3COO{H_2}^+$)
